it's the war memorial in Landau (Palatinate), a work of sculpterer Bernhard Bleeker and was unveiled in Aug. 1936. It's generally known to the public as 'Landauer Löwe' (Lion of Landau). Landau's coat of arms shows a black lion and Palatiante belonged to Bavaria from 1815 until 1945, Bavaria also has a lion in its state symbols.
